Ambassador Extraordinary and Plenipotentiary of the Federal Republic of Brazil to Turkmenistan assumed his duties
Published 10.12.2024
1807

On December 10, 2024, in accordance with the instructions of President Serdar Berdimuhamedov, the Chairwoman of the Mejlis D. Gulmanova received credentials from the newly appointed Ambassador Extraordinary and Plenipotentiary of the Federative Republic of Brazil to Turkmenistan Marcel Fortuna Biato.

On behalf of the President of Turkmenistan, the head of the Mejlis congratulated the Ambassador on the start of his diplomatic mission in Turkmenistan, wishing him success in his noble activities aimed at expanding bilateral cooperation.

Thanking for the warm welcome, the Ambassador conveyed sincere congratulations and best wishes to President Serdar Berdimuhamedov and the Turkmen people on the occasion of the International Day of Neutrality from the President of the Federative Republic of Brazil Luiz Inácio Lula da Silva.

During the meeting, the Ambassador of Brazil was informed in detail about the grand transformations and large-scale reforms being carried out in Turkmenistan.

The Chairwoman of the Mejlis also informed the diplomat about the activities of the Parliament, which plays a key role in improving the national legislation that serves as a basis for the progressive balanced development of Turkmenistan.

The sides highly appraised the prospects of Turkmen-Brazilian interaction in both bilateral and multilateral formats, including within the framework of international organizations and as part of dialogue between Turkmenistan and Latin American countries, expressing mutual interest in intensifying the interstate cooperation.

It was noted that business circles of Brazil show great interest in the potential opportunities for establishing mutually beneficial cooperation, for activation of which encouraging preconditions are created by Turkmenistan’s “open door” policy, including the favorable investment climate.

At the end of the meeting, Ambassador Extraordinary and Plenipotentiary of the Federative Republic of Brazil to Turkmenistan Marcel Fortuna Biato assured the Head of the National Parliament that he would make every effort to further strengthen the traditionally friendly Turkmen-Brazilian relations.
